Kanye Calls Out Drake On Twitter

Kanye’s back on his bullshit—and he’s calling Drizzy out.

Ye went on a tweeting rampage about Drake after he got a text asking to give Drake clearance of the 2009 song “Say What’s Real,” which samples Kanye’s “Say You Will” beat. But he explains that he’s tight he never received an apology from him and reiterated that he never told Pusha about Drake’s son or tried to diss him.

He just tweeted that Drake finally called…and in typical Kanye fashion, he didn’t clear the sample.

Stay petty, ye.

Kobe Bryant Creating Young Adult Novels

Kobe found a new way to occupy his time after retiring—helping create a new young adult novel series where fantasy meets sports.

The Wizenard Series is written by Wesley King and aims to help inspire young athletes. The first installment of the series, The Wizenard Series: Training Camp, will be arriving at major bookstores on March 19, 2019. It is also currently available for pre-order on Amazon.

The Amazon description reads, “The West Bottom Badgers are the worst youth basketball team in the league. That is until one summer when a new coach gives them the chance to change everything. Rolabi Wizenard and his magical coaching techniques cover offense, defense, individual strengths and weaknesses, and physical conditioning. Through basketball, he shows his players that working at each of these will not only make them stronger physically, but also mentally and emotionally.”

Kid Cudi Talks Mental Health With Jada and Willow

In a new episode of Jada Pinkett Smith’s “Red Table Talk” series, Kid Cudi will speak about mental health.

“I was really good at keeping my troubles hidden… even from my friends,” Cudi said. “I really was good with that. And it’s scary because you hear people say, ‘I had no clue.'”

“I really went out of my way to keep what I was going through hidden because I was ashamed,” he continued.

You can catch the new episode on Monday via Facebook Watch.
